Microsoft Outlook - Email - How to Print Outlook Attachments Without Saving Them

Step-by-Step Procedures

  1. How to print a single attachments.
    1. Open Outlook web or New Outlook desktop app.
    2. Click the email that contains the attachment.
    3. Click on the attachment name (do NOT click Download).
    4. The file will open in a preview window (Office files like Word, Excel, PDF usually open automatically).
    5. If prompted, choose Open instead of Download.
    6. Click the Print option
    7. Select your printer.
    8. Click Print.
    9. The file prints without you manually saving it to your computer.
  2. How to print a bulk attachments in Outlook Classic desktop app only.
    Note: Outlook Web and New Outlook does not have a “print all attachments” button. You must print them one at a time.
    1. In Outlook, click File, Print, and Print Options.

    2. Check the box next to “Print attached files. Attachments will print to the default printer only.” Then click Preview.

    3. Hit the back arrow and go to the email you’d like to bulk print attachments from. Right-click it and select Quick Print.

    4. A prompt will appear asking if you’d like to Open or Save the document. Click Open.
    5. The files print without you manually saving them to your computer.
